A day in the life of a Murphy Planning Manager

 

  • Manage the planning team on a day-to-day basis
  • Drive implementation and use of planning and project controls procedures and processes
  • Line and/or functional management of planners, including management of external planning resources
  • Develop capability across the team to deliver high quality standards and outputs
  • Apply a consistent audit and review approach to ensure planning requirements are met, reduce non-compliance and improve project and business performance
  • Manage the structured and controlled use of enterprise planning tools
  • Contribute to the development of business unit and sector plans and strategies
  • Review and apply client-specific requirements
  • Maintain effective working relationships with clients and project stakeholders (internal and external)
  • Ensure integrated, whole life programmes are developed from first principles in line with planning and work winning procedures
  • Contribute to business development activities to identify, pursue and secure projects
  • Ensure alignment with work winning governance processes in relation to planning outputs
  • Ensure tender programmes are critically reviewed to confirm that planning and scheduling are appropriate, contractually compliant, robust and deliverable
  • Ensure integrated, whole life programmes are developed and maintained from first principles in line with planning procedures and contract requirements
  • Ensure accurate and transparent reporting of progress, risks and issues related to the programme
  • Ensure programmes and associated reports are regularly updated and submitted to the client in line with contract requirements
  • Apply change control processes for identifying, notifying and quantifying time impacts relating to delay, disruption and change
  • Maintain alignment between Operations, Commercial and Planning teams to ensure consistent project information
  • Contribute to the identification, management and mitigation of project risks
  • Facilitate planning and project teams in resolving risks and issues

 

Still interested, does this sound like you?

 

  • Experience as a Planning and Project Controls Manager
  • Experience managing a team of planners
  • Contract and tender planning experience within a Tier 1 contractor
  • Fully proficient in the use of P6 planning software
  • Stakeholder management experience, including representing the organisation in client-facing planning and business performance meetings
  • Experience in mentoring, coaching and professional development
